COURSEWORK- MATHS DATA HANDLING MAYFIELD HIGH SCHOOL Mayfield High School is a fictitious high school. There are 1183 pupils in the database I have on the school. This data has come from the exam board, and so is made up. I am going to examine the many features of the data, and investigate the inter-effect they all have on each other. The data base has 27 features for each pupil: Year group, surname, forename 1 and 2, age in years and months, month of birthday, gender, hair colour, eye colour, whether the person is left or right handed, favourite colour, favourite sport, favourite lesson, favourite TV program, Average number of hours TV watched per week, IQ, height, weight, distance travelled to school every day, type of transport to school number of siblings, number of pets, and Key Stage Three results in maths, science and English.
